Ron Ely, Iconic Tarzan Actor, Passes Away at 86

Ron Ely, the actor known for his role in the 1960s "Tarzan" series, has died at 86, leaving behind a legacy of acting and writing.

Overview

A summary of the key points of this story verified across multiple sources.

Ron Ely, best known for portraying Tarzan in the 1960s NBC series, has died at 86. Ely's daughter announced his passing, highlighting his influential life as a father and mentor. Throughout his career, Ely performed his own stunts and hosted the Miss America pageant in the 1980s. He retired from acting in 2001 to focus on family but made a brief return in 2014. Ely faced personal tragedies, including the violent deaths of his wife and son in 2019, leading to a civil lawsuit against authorities. He leaves behind a legacy that resonates with affection and admiration from family and fans alike.
